This is the autobiography of a celebrated ornithologist, the late Salim Ali. Looking back at the age of eighty-seven, the author narrates a story which is packed with adventure in the outdoors. He traces his earliest fascination for birds to the time that he first shot a Yellowthroated Sparrow and had it identified at the office of the Bombay Natural History Society, several years before World War l.Ali, Sálim is the author of 'Fall of a Sparrow ', published 2007 under ISBN 9780195687477 and ISBN 0195687477.
